Thanks for the compliment Chedly... although those pictures above are actually Fs19.
blue_painted wrote: Thu Aug 12, 2021 10:53 am One of my pre-play processes on a new map is to make sure that there are collisions on power line poles, and if necessary to make the small area of dead ground around the foot of the pole -- and I also put full collisions on hedges!
I definitely agree about having collisions on the powerline poles in a field as well as the dead area around then that is covered in weeds.
The hedge collisions is one of those things I can never decide which I like best. We've gone with no hedge cols, bale (and combine header) cols only, and full hedge cols.

For me there definitely needs to be some col on the hedge.

I go with the very narrow cube inside the hedge with full cols, so that my tractor can "lean" on the hedge rather than hit a solid invisible wall, but as a player I am not able to bash through hedges regardless, and I'll "soften" the hedge around gateways etc.
One of these fine days, when I finally get around to making my own map, I'll work out to make realistic ditches, and then I'll let the hedges have no cols on them.
